The Appeal

Designed by Ian Callum, and unveiled at the 2001 Geneva Motor Show, the V12 Vanquish was a Grand Tourer for the fresh millennium. This was the company’s new flagship - a powerful, beautifully styled, evocative tourer that embodied much of the luxury brand’s heritage, without staying too far in the past. 
The result was a heavily lauded, much-loved and super-aspirational car, one that’s appeared in films, video games, and more. After all, it’s perhaps the most legendary of the 21st century Bond Cars…

The Mechanics 

  • Powered by the incredibly impressive 5.9L V12 Engine - producing 460hp
  • Automated 6-speed manual transmission with paddle shift (a departure for Aston Martin at the time)
  • ABS and electric brake distribution
Opening up the car’s bonnet reveals an incredibly impressive powerplant. The 5.9L V12 is a 460hp behemoth that’s beautifully capped by Aston Martin’s branding. It’s reassuringly big and tactile, with the engine bay evidently being clean, well-cared for and free of any concerns.
